Vt. begins laying track for rail corridor

Once the work is completed along two separate stretches next year, it will leave an 11-mile gap that must be filled to complete the 75-mile track upgrade between Rutland and Burlington. Officials hope to learn next month if a federal grant for that project will be approved.

DART opens 2 new rail segments

DART has built more than 40 miles of track in the last three years, greatly enhancing transit accessibility throughout the Dallas area. At 85 miles, DART Rail is the largest electric light rail system in the nation.

Phoenix taps route, mode for extension project

Light rail will be extended 11 miles from downtown Phoenix, through the State Capitol area.This is Metro’s first freeway corridor project, providing the growing West Valley with a higher-capacity and more efficient transit option by 2023.

CATS rail extension to UNC Charlotte receives state funding

The 9.4-mile alignment would run from Uptown Charlotte to the UNC Charlotte campus and include 11 light rail stations and four parking facilities.

Calif. light rail extension issues Notice to Proceed

Notice affords the Kiewit Parsons Joint Venture the ability to implement all aspects of the design-build contract, including design and construction of the 11.5-miles of tracks, stations, crossings, bridges, utilities, maintenance facility and more. The total project budget is $735 million.
